Heim >Backend-Entwicklung >Python-Tutorial >So lesen Sie Werte in Excel in Python

So lesen Sie Werte in Excel in Python

(*-*)浩
(*-*)浩Original
2019-07-01 10:34:347369Durchsuche

Während des letzten Testprozesses musste ich Python verwenden, um Excel-Anwendungsfalldaten zu lesen, also habe ich die XLRD-Bibliothek verstanden und erlernt. Hier zeichnen wir nur die Vorgänge auf, die mit dem Lesen von Excel-Daten während der Verwendung zusammenhängen.

So lesen Sie Werte in Excel in Python

Installieren Sie die xlrd-Bibliothek (empfohlenes Lernen: Python-Video-Tutorial)

Sie können die xlrd herunterladen Bibliothekspaket zur lokalen Installation oder über den pip-Befehl. Hier wähle ich den pip-Befehl:

pip install xlrd

XLRD zum Lesen von Excel-Daten verwenden

Detaillierte Informationen zu den Vorgängen finden Sie in der Bedienungsanleitung der XLRD-Bibliothek . Im Folgenden finden Sie zwei Methoden zum Lesen von Excel-Daten:

Daten entsprechend dem Blattnamen in Excel lesen:

 import xlrd
def readExcelDataByName(fileName, sheetName):
    table = None
    errorMsg = None
    try:
        data = xlrd.open_workbook(fileName)
        table = data.sheet_by_name(sheetName)
    except Exception, msg:
        errorMsg = msg  
    return table, errorMsg

Entsprechend der Seriennummer von das Blatt in Excel:

 import xlrd
def readExcelDataByIndex(fileName, sheetIndex):
    table = None
    errorMsg = ""
    try:
        data = xlrd.open_workbook(fileName)
        table = data.sheet_by_index(sheetIndex)
    except Exception, msg:
        errorMsg = msg
    return table, errorMsg

Weitere technische Artikel zum Thema Python finden Sie in der Spalte Python-Tutorial, um mehr darüber zu erfahren!

Das obige ist der detaillierte Inhalt vonSo lesen Sie Werte in Excel in Python.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:Wie man Ajax in Python crawltNächster Artikel:Wie man Ajax in Python crawlt